If I select "Run Locally" to run my console EXE from Visual Studio and then
(after it exits) try to rebuild the project the rebuild fails with "The process
cannot access the file 'bin\Debug\ConsoleApplication1.exe' because it is being
used by another process."

This does not happen if I run it under MS .NET (ie. Debug, Start Without
Debugging).

Reproducible: Sometimes

Steps to Reproduce:
1. Open a Console Application project in Visual Studio.
2. Select Mono, Run Locally.
3. Exit the application.
4. Select Build, Rebuild Solution.
Actual Results:  
Build fails with the following error:

c:\WINDOWS\Microsoft.NET\Framework\v3.5\Microsoft.Common.targets(2606,9): error
MSB3021: Unable to copy file "obj\Debug\ConsoleApplication1.exe" to
"bin\Debug\ConsoleApplication1.exe". The process cannot access the file
'bin\Debug\ConsoleApplication1.exe' because it is being used by another
process.

Expected Results:  
Build succeeds.

Windows XP Pro x64 SP2, Visual Studio 2008 Pro SP1
MonoVS 0.7.4221
